Sumario:Leishmaniasis is an endemic chronic degenerative disease of the mountains and jungle of Peru causing a social stigma in people who suffer from the wounds it causes. In vivo models make it necessary to study this neglected disease. In the present study immunosuppressed hamsters Mesocricetus auratus were infected with promastigotes of L. infantum, L. brazilensis, L. guyanensis and L. peruviana cultivated in vitro in order to observe the progression of the disease in four months. No disease progression was observed in the time stipulated probably by loss of virulence of the Leishmania sp. promastigotes used in the challenge. The results show that infection and progression of leishmaniasis requires conditions such as virulence and viability and that this is lost due to the passages in vitro cultures.
